Draymond Green and Rasheed Wallace Get Heat in 2017 Warriors Debate

Former Pistons player Rasheed Wallace had a trade with Draymond Green about whether the 2004 Pistons could beat the 2017 Warriors.

Golden State's 2017 team was one of the best offensive teams in NBA history, while Detroit's 2004 team was among the best defensive teams ever.

Last week, Wallace stirred things up when he said his 2004 Pistons team would cause problems for the Dubs.

“We were going to beat the sh*t out [the Warriors] because the simple truth is, they couldn't match us in any position,” said Wallace Sheed & Tyler. “Steph is not a defender. He had to watch over Rip. How many screens come out of Rip,” Wallace said confidently. He then named what he felt were other matchup issues such as Tayshaun Prince's scoring ability, which he often lacked due to his superior wing defense, and the play of Chauncy Billups.”

Green answered X, “Sheed we would have hit yall. Yall averaged 72 points per game. That's not half winning. And we put you and those big-ass armies through all the picking and rolling. Let's see you move your feet. That one ring was beautiful even though it was big. We all appreciated it!”

Wallace then beat Green back to X, but made sure to make it clear that there was nothing but love between the two.

“First of all this is not beef, Draymond is my proud lil bro so no matter what we say it will never be personal so don't try to blow this up because we both know how cats act!! !”

He then responded to Green's tweet, saying, “Dray knows how we got down on that squad!!
